editVerb
editкараш • (karaš) (type II conjugation)
- to open wide (eyes, mouth), to stare, to gape
- to yell, to scream, to cry out loud
- Synonym: кычкыраш (kyčkyraš)
- to caw (crows)
- to meow (cats)
- пырыс почешем карен коштеш
- pyrys počešem karen košteš
- a cat is following me and is meowing
- to bleat (sheep)
- шорык-шамыч карат
- šoryk-šamyč karat
- sheep are bleating
- to grunt (pigs)
- сӧсна кара
- sösna kara
- the pig is grunting
